Figure 2

A) Structural model of HECT-domain E3 complex. The mechanism for the conjugation of Ub to a substrate by a HECT-domain E3 is shown. The E2 binds the N-terminal lobe of the HECT-domain E3 (top) and transfers Ub to the C-terminal lobe via a thiolester linkage (middle). The C-terminal lobe swivels on a hinge-loop and catalyzes the transfer of Ub to the substrate protein (bottom). B) Model of U-box or monomeric RING finger E3s. The U-box or RING finger domains of the E3 are directly involved in binding the E2. C) Model of SCF complexes. The N-terminus of CUL-1 binds the adaptor Skp1 (SKR proteins in C. elegans), while the C-terminus binds the RING finger protein Rbx1, which binds the E2. The substrate recognition subunit (SRS) binds to Skp1 through an F-box motif. D) Model of CUL-2-based E3 complexes. The N-terminus of CUL-2 binds to the adaptor elongin C (ELC-1), which is in complex with elongin B (ELB-1). The SRS binds to elongin C through a BC-box motif. E) Model of CUL-3-based E3 complexes. The N-terminus of CUL-3 binds directly to the SRS, which utilizes a BTB/POZ domain to bind to CUL-3.
